Biotechnology Involves The Manipulation Of Living Organisms Or Their Components To Develop New Products Or Processes. In The Context Of Healthcare, Biotechnology Is Utilized In The Production Of Pharmaceuticals, Diagnostics, And Therapies. Biopharmaceuticals, On The Other Hand, Are Drugs That Are Produced Using Biological Processes, Such As Recombinant DNA Technology. These Drugs Are Often Derived From Living Organisms, Such As Proteins, Antibodies, And Nucleic Acids.
One Of The Key Advantages Of Biotech Biopharma Is The Ability To Develop Highly Targeted And Personalized Therapies. By Leveraging The Unique Biological Properties Of Living Organisms, Researchers Can Create Precision Medicines That Are Tailored To A Patient’s Specific Genetic Makeup Or Disease Characteristics. This Approach Has Led To The Development Of Therapies That Are More Effective And Have Fewer Side Effects Compared To Traditional Pharmaceuticals.

One Of The Most Exciting Areas Of Growth In Biotech Biopharma Is The Field Of Gene Therapy. Gene Therapy Involves The Introduction Of Genetic Material Into A Patient’s Cells To Treat Or Prevent Disease. This Approach Has The Potential To Revolutionize The Treatment Of Genetic Disorders, As Well As Other Complex Diseases Such As Cancer And Neurodegenerative Conditions. Several Gene Therapies Have Already Been Approved By Regulatory Agencies Around The World, Marking A Significant Milestone In The Field.
Immunotherapy Is Another Area Of Biotech Biopharma That Is Showing Great Promise In The Treatment Of Cancer And Other Diseases. Immunotherapy Harnesses The Power Of The Immune System To Target And Destroy Cancer Cells, Offering A More Targeted And Less Toxic Alternative To Traditional Treatments Such As Chemotherapy And Radiation Therapy. Several Immunotherapies Have Been Approved For The Treatment Of Various Cancers, With Many More In Development.
